Texas is a team that is very interesting. Basically all of the squad returns and this is the year that well, they got to get it done. They have not made the Final Four since the 2003 National Championship. This year they have the pieces to do it but they will have to do it under a new coach since Shaka Smart left for Marquette. Now, Chris Beard will have to gain the trust of this experienced core.
